I have been there. I had a headache for several months. I had heard of my friends mom having an anorisim. I then started thinking of tumors. After going to the Doctors several times then a physiatris, I was told that all the muscles in my head were constricting and causing pain. The more i worried the more they remained tense. After i was convinced the muscles started to relax and then it went away. Then after that I moved on to worrying about something else. (haha)but true!

your mind is a very powerful tool!
